Transaction 56dbce5f790e6433a4e4408c6e1b429c754a1f8f2eafcbb71f4286c4b919eb3a
2 Input
2 Outputs
- 56dbce5f790e6433a4e4408c6e1b429c754a1f8f2eafcbb71f4286c4b919eb3a:0
- 56dbce5f790e6433a4e4408c6e1b429c754a1f8f2eafcbb71f4286c4b919eb3a:1
value 2623500000
address 1DpDKtHZvVz4cNxwQQGKnVXSDCrG66isR8
value 13017824976
address 19EVBFUVG4hQBCtppM4ptm3923f2YRe36W